RAKOTT KRUMPLI RECIPE HUNGARIAN LAYERED POTATOES
Rakott krumpli is a gloriously simple layered potato recipe from Hungary, eggs and smoked sausage are all layered up with sour cream to make a super-rich and delicious dish.

Steps:
- Bring a pan of well-salted water to the boil.
- Add in the potatoes and the eggs.
- Boil the eggs for 10 minutes before removing.
- Remove the potatoes after 30 minutes.
- Allow both to cool for 10 minutes and then peel both.
- Mix the egg yolk with the sour cream.
- Cut the sausage, boiled eggs and potatoes into 3-4mm thick slices.
- Grease an 18cm X 12cm gratin dish with butter.
- Layer up the dish starting with potatoes, then sausage, then egg and then a third of the sour cream.
- Season this layer with salt and pepper and add another identical layer.
- Finish with a layer of potatoes and then add the remaining sour cream.
- Place in an oven and cook for an hour at 200°C or 400°F.

RAKOTT KRUMPLI
Rakott Krumpli or layered potato is a traditional Hungarian casserole. This is an incredibly tasty, quite simple and quick dish to make.

Steps:
- In a deep pan cook potato in the skin for 15 minutes, without being overcooked. Remove the potatoes from the water and set aside to cool, then peel and slice them.
- In another pan, boil the eggs for 15 minutes to be cooked hard. When eggs are cooked, peel and slice them.
- Coat the baking dish with oil and put: - A row of potatoes (be sure to salt), a row of sausages, a row of eggs (be sure to salt) and coat with sour cream - A row of potatoes (be sure to salt), a row of sausages, a row of eggs (be sure to salt) and coat with sour cream - A row of potatoes (be sure to salt) and coat with sour cream
- Place in oven and bake for 35-40 min at 200 C.
- Serve Rakott Krumpli with pickled cucumbers or beetroot or any other pickled vegetable.

RAKOTT KRUMPLI - MAIN COURSE - BOLD AND TASTY

- Put potatoes in the pot, cover them with water, and bring it to boil. Once boiling, simmer potatoes until tender around 20 minutes. Once cooked, cool them down and peel.
- Boil 5 eggs. Once eggs start to boil, reduce heat, and cook for 8 minutes. After the time is up, cool down eggs in an ice bath or under running cold water. Once cold, peel them.
- While potatoes are cooking, cut bacon and sausage into medium cubes. Place them into the cold pan and start sauteing them on low heat for 5-10 minutes.
- Prepare custard mixture. Beat together whole eggs, heavy cream, sour cream, freshly grated nutmeg, salt, and pepper.
